An isosceles triangle has one vertex angle and two congruent base angles. Also, we know that the sum of all angles in a triangle must equal 180 degrees. So we can say that:
Vertex Angle + Base Angle + Base Angle = 180.
Vertex Angle + 2 x (Base Angle) = 180.
2 x (Base Angle) = 180 - Vertex Angle
2 x (Base Angle) = 180 - 42
2 x (Base Angle) = 138
Base Angle = 69
Also, we know that angles on one side of a straight line always add to 180 degrees.
So we can say that:
Base Angle + ? = 180
? = 180 - Base Angle
? = 180 - 69
? = 111
